The minute this came up, I would have issued a refund, added her to my blocked buyers list and moved on. In my opinion, it is almost always a mistake to get eBay involved. Their judgment is not always fair and sometimes the mere ACCUSATION of selling a phake item will get your account closed. Not always, but sometimes.

When an eBay transaction goes south, it is no longer about making a profit on that item, or even getting it back. It is all about damage control. When this happens to me, my goal is to make the buyer go away as quickly as possible, preferably without leaving a negative feedback.

There are some people on eBay who do this type of thing to get free merchandise. And I hate being taken advantage of. But they can only do it to me ONCE. And these buyers eventually get what is coming to them. If they have too many cases opened or claims filed, eBay is likely to boot them as well. eBay is very profitable, but the profits depend on automation. When a live person has to get involved, their profit on the transaction goes away very quickly and turns into a loss.

Remember, you are in business to make money. Anything that takes your focus away from that is to be avoided like the plague!
